jQuery UI Accordion option()方法

  • Post category:jquery

以下是关于 jQuery UI Accordion option() 方法的详细攻略:

jQuery UI Accordion option() 方法

jQuery UI Accordion option() 方法用于获取或设置折叠面板的选项。该方法可以通过 jQuery UI Accordion 实例调用。

语法

$( ".selector" ).accordion( "option", optionName );
$( ".selector" ).accordion( "option", optionName, value );
$( ".selector" ).accordion( "option", options );

参数

  • optionName:要获取或设置的选项名称。
  • value:要设置的选项值。
  • options:一个包含一个或多个选项名称和值的对象。

返回值

如果只传递了一个参数 optionName,则该方法返回该选项的当前值。如果传递了两个参数 optionName 和 value,则该方法设置该选项的值并返回 jQuery 对象。如果传递了一个对象 options,则该方法设置多个选项的值并返回 jQuery 对象。

示例一:获取选项值

 activeIndex = $( "#myAccordion" ).accordion( "option", "active" );

这将获取 id 为 myAccordion 的折叠面板的 active 选项的当前值。

示例二:设置选项值

$( "#myAccordion" ).accordion( "option", "active", 2 );

这将设置 id 为 myAccordion 的折叠面板的 active 选项的值为 2。

示例三:设置多个选项值

$( "#myAccordion" ).accordion( "option", {
  active: 2,
  collapsible: true
});

这将设置 id 为 myAccordion 的折叠面板的 active 选项的值为 2,并将 collapsible 选项的值设置为 true。

总结:

jQuery UI Accordion option() 方法用于获取或设置折叠面板的选项。该方法可以通过 jQuery UI Accordion 实例调用。使用该方法可以控制折叠面板的行为和外观。

以上是关于 jQuery UI Accordion option() 方法的详细攻略,包括语法、参数、返回值和三个示例。